Supportive Apartments
Supportive Apartments, located across the road from the Trempealeau County Health Care Center, provides residency in an adult family home setting. The houses (Elmwood, Maplewood, Oakwood and Pinewood) each have two tenants living in a supervised environment. The accommodations are fully furnished and provide a private bedroom for each resident.
Objectives
- Individual empowerment based on needs with support of quality services
- Integration into community living, working, learning and leisure activities
- Maintenance and enhancement of individual living skills
- Enhancement and acquisition of skills necessary for independent living
Criteria
- Capability to perform basic independent living and social skills
- At least 18 years of age
- Willingness to cooperate with a treatment plan
- Capability to self-supervise for blocks of time each day
- Basic ability to structure leisure time
- Ability to negotiate stairs
Supportive Services
- Medication management (monitoring and education)
- Crisis intervention and emergency response services
- Vocational Program participation including vocational training and job placement
- Psychiatric follow-up
- Local transportation
- Social and recreational activities
- Information and referral support
- Problem-solving and decision-making education
- Meals and snacks
Staffing
- 24-hour awake staff
- Personal Care Workers or Certified Nurse Aides
- RN assessment and supervision
- Contracted psychiatrist for follow-up and consultation
